Takeout centered restaurant with the usual and the unusual on its well planned menu. Food is expertly prepared and comes in waves to the table.
Our chicken satay and crispy pork belly starters were both spicy and enjoyable, the peanut dip and the sweet and sour dip worked well and the chilli-laden table sauces let us amp up the heat.
My Pad Kra Tiam with Chicken was onion forward and garlicky and rounded out my meal well. The portions are generous!
The staff are hard at work servicing a stream of takeout orders but we never felt abandoned at our table.
This is a great place to come and experience Thai food.

GREAT place! First, let me say that we truly appreciated when the cook came out to clarify vegetarian or vegan for my partner. Many Thai and Asian restaurants use Oyster or fish sauce in their dishes. The person taking our order seemed unsure. So we were thankful that the cook came to clarify.
This restaurant offers delicious food quickly. They have awesome outdoor seating on a large patio.
They also feature great beer, and stock the very first Thai beer to be brewed in the U.S. (Tom Kha).
Highly recommend stopping here when visiting Anacortes.
